    What is Dr. Franklyn Christensen's specialty?

    Dr. Christensen is a Maternal & Fetal Medicine Specialist near Corpus Christi, TX. An obstetrician/gynecologist who specializes in the care of patients with pregnancy complications provides consultation and management for those experiencing obstetrical, medical, and surgical issues related to pregnancy. This specialist has advanced knowledge of the effects of these complications on both the mother and the fetus, as well as expertise in the latest diagnostic and treatment modalities for managing complicated pregnancies.
